Tigers’ Ayden Tomlinson is 3rd in Oct. 16 golf match

BY CLIFF SMELLEY

Union County High School played Branford in boys golf on Oct. 16 in Lake City, with the Tigers’ Ayden Tomlinson finishing in third place behind co-medalists Jon Weisner and Easton Young.

Branford won with a team score of 214, while Union had a score of 238.

Tomlinson shot a 54 to finish five strokes behind Branford’s Weisner and Young.

Emery Muse was fifth with a score of 58, while Gavin Kuhn was in a two-way tie for sixth with a score of 61.

Brysen Tomlinson and Fenix Norman were ninth and 10th, respectively, with scores of 65 and 66.

The Tigers entered the match off a loss to host Madison County on Oct. 14.

Madison had a score of 164 to Union’s 218.

The Tigers were led by Ayden Tomlinson’s fifth-place finish. Tomlinson made par on two holes in finishing with a score of 47.

Kuhn and Brysen Tomlinson were sixth and seventh, respectively, with scores of 51 and 55. Each made par on one hole.

Norman shot a ninth-place score of 65, while Muse shot an 11th-place score of 67.
